What Exactly Are Autoplay and Quick Spin Options?

Autoplay lets me pre-set a number of spins that run automatically, eliminating the need to click the spin button each time. I choose anywhere from 10 to 1,000 consecutive rounds, relax, and watch the reels work while I take in the graphics or switch tabs. Quick spin, on the other hand, accelerates the reel animation speed. Instead of a leisurely spin sequence that drags out for seconds, the symbols lock into place almost instantly. When I activate both simultaneously at Oscar Spin Casino, I step into a high-cadence trance where decisions happen in split-second intervals, and the sheer volume of outcomes explodes. It’s the ultimate shortcut for anyone who craves rapid-fire gameplay without sacrificing any of the underlying maths or RTP integrity.

Setting Loss and Win Limits

I always start by setting a single-spin loss threshold and a total session loss cap, because Murphy’s law applies to autoplay if I overlook them. Oscar Spin Casino’s provider partners typically let me input a dollar value that instantly stops the reel run the moment my balance goes past it. On the flip side, I set a win ceiling that captures profits before a hot streak turns. There’s nothing more satisfying than returning to my screen and seeing the autoplay stopped dead because I hit a monster bonus round that smashed my target. These limits are not about pessimism; they’re about protecting my dopamine from turning into regret five minutes later.

Enhanced Stop Conditions You Shouldn’t Overlook

Beyond raw cash limits, I pay attention to feature triggers. Some slots at Oscar Spin Casino allow me to tell autoplay to stop when free spins are won, or when a jackpot round is activated. I never want a machine to auto-click through a pick-me bonus that requires my input. Similarly, the “stop on any win over” function is a gem I use on multiplier-heavy games. If a single spin pays 50x my stake, I want the reel action frozen so I can appreciate the moment or adjust my bet. These subtle toggles transform autoplay from a blunt instrument into a surgeon’s scalpel, precisely cutting whenever the game state demands my attention.
